Spyglass Gainesville is located at 701 SW 62nd Blvd, Gainesville, 32607, United States. These student apartments in Gainesville blend convenience with a laid-back student vibe. Spyglass Gainesville offers well-designed 1-bedroom & 3-bedroom apartments, with floor plans reaching up to 1,188 sq ft. It’s the kind of setup where you can enjoy your own space while still sharing life with roommates or friends. The University of Florida is just a 13-minute drive away, while the UF College of Veterinary Medicine can be reached in around 10 minutes. Spyglass Gainesville FL, offers a range of options like 1 Bed 1 Bath & 3 Bed 3 Bath layouts, each thoughtfully furnished to make student life easier. All apartments at Spyglass Gainesville feature a bed, walk-in closets, & a furniture package. You’ll have carpeting, a ceiling fan, & central AC and heating. The kitchen comes with a dishwasher, disposal unit, microwave, & refrigerator. There’s also a patio/balcony for fresh air &, in some units, a tennis court view. For security, you get a monitored alarm system at the Gainesville student housing. A washer and dryer are provided in every unit, along with window coverings for privacy.
Spyglass Apartments Gainesville community comes packed with common amenities. You can take a dip in the swimming pool, relax in the hot tub, or soak up the sun on the sundeck. Fitness enthusiasts will appreciate the free weight & cardio center, while tennis lovers can make use of the on-site court. Other conveniences include bike racks, an RTS bus route to UF & Santa Fe College, a trash and recycling disposal area, a dog park, & even a free on-site math tutor. The business center, gas grill on the pool deck, & a welcoming community atmosphere make it easy to balance work, play, & relaxation. Safety is also taken seriously, with controlled access/gated entry, an on-site courtesy officer, & regular maintenance checks. Getting around Gainesville is straightforward. The nearest bus stops are Spyglass Apartments (344 ft away) & Lakewood Villas Apartments (384 ft away), which put you right on the RTS route. The nearest train station is Waldo Station (19.8 miles away), & for longer trips, Gainesville Regional Airport is only 11.9 miles from your doorstep.
